I thought the breaking bad finale had issues then read Norm's (since deleted) twitter thread and his interpretation makes it into a masterpiece. that Walt died frozen and unknown in the car in New Hampshire and the rest of the episode was his dying fantasy with clues coming from the music, dialogue being strange and full of movie references, his ability to go anywhere as a fugitive without difficulty, reconciling with his wife, outsmarting his business partners, rigging up a magic gun to wipe out the nazis and free Jesse, then dying as the smartest man in town. This site has a summary https://bleedingcool.com/movies/norm-macdonald-tells-you-how-breaking-bad-really-ended/ I know El Camino doesn't support this theory but still Norm may have been right.
